This one is directed purely at the boys, but ladies feel free to chime in.
Before I continue, please be 100% clear I don't want sympathy etc, I've never been lick my wounds and feel sorry for myself. What I do want it to draw attention to something that I think most of us guys don't bother doing. Not something I particularly want to tell others about if I'm honest, but I think it's important that others learn from my mistake.
So a couple of months ago in the shower I noticed a lump in one of my testicles. No idea how long it had been there, I don't check to be honest. Sorry for the graphic details! Have to admit I've been fatigued a lot recently, but I've taken on a new role at work and have been spending too many hours there so I put it down to that. Did what I usually would do, ignored it, it will go away etc. Well it didn't, it still hasn't. Went to the doctor about three weeks ago, referred to specialist etc. Yesterday I was informed I have testicular cancer.
Quite a surreal experience yesterday to put it mildly. Defined currently as stage 2 so the prognosis is pretty good. Surgeon, (cross your legs lads), is sharpening his scalpel to remove Mr Left Testicle in the very near future, at this stage there is no sign of any spread elsewhere in the usual secondary areas. I'll obviously need chemo after the surgery, but should make a decent recovery. Statistically the numbers are pretty good.
Again - No sympathy. I'm uncomfortable typing this. If I'm truthful I've typed it and deleted it a couple of times as I'm not really one for sharing stuff like this. What I do want is simple. Guys - Check! Over here in the UK the women are lectured about breast cancer constantly, testicular cancer nowhere near as much.
Please please please CHECK. (Just don't pm me about your nuts ok)
